ADT is the largest security provider in America, but they often don't install systems directly. Instead, they authorize dealers like SafeStreets to sell and install their equipment. These authorized dealers must meet ADT's standards and use ADT's monitoring centers.
When you sign up with SafeStreets, you're getting ADT monitoring and equipment, installed by a company that specializes in installation rather than monitoring.
Vivint takes a different approach. They handle everything in-house: sales, installation, equipment manufacturing, and monitoring. This vertical integration allows for tighter quality control but sometimes at a higher price point.
Their smart home integration is particularly impressive—in my testing, their system worked more seamlessly with other devices than any competitor.
Here's something most companies won't tell you: many local security dealers use the same central monitoring stations. Companies like Alarm.com provide the backend for numerous local and regional security providers.
This means the actual emergency response process might be identical whether you go with a local company or a national brand—the difference often comes down to installation quality and customer service.

Lake Charles has a population of 145,029 and is located in Calcasieu County. According to recent ACS data from the U.S. Census Bureau, the median household income is $44,785. Median home value is $156,152, and the median rent is $830/month. With a median age of 35.5 years old, 26.2% of residents over the age of 24 have at least some college education, with 19.3% having an income over $100,000. 39.5% of households are married.
